Smeg's Small Space Washer With Sink

012109Smeg.jpgHere's a small space design we'd like to see make it's way Stateside, the Smeg LBL16RO Washing Machine with sink. The cute pink washer comes equipped with 15 programmed wash cycles, wash load capacity of 5 kg, an LCD display, anti-flood/foaming features, and a 31X33X13 cm ontop of it all, making this our dream small apartment washing machine.
